Virtual Letter - Essay Example When bringing you up I applied different theories and principles in order to make sure that you grow as a good person. My principle is to abide by the Christian teaching and refuse what is evil. According to social learning theory, by Bandura people learn behaviour whether good or bad from the people around them. I was much strict to make sure that you only learn the behaviour that is acceptable to the community and Christian teaching. When you were only 15 years, you wanted to go out with your boyfriend but I opposed. This is because it is not good to go out and have sex before marriage as it is forbidden by the society and Christian teachings. When I noticed that this could come as a result of peer pressure or learned from your friend, I had to forbid you from interacting with bad people. This made you to even avoid class discussion and interaction with other students in the schools. My parents used authoritarian parenting styles, and this has shaped my behaviour and enabled me to uphold religious and moral values. In order for you to grow up with moral and Christian values, I had to apply the same principles and parenting styles my parents used. In the process of growing, you adopted different behaviour. When you were two years as described by Erikson, you could trust the environment and people around you. When I left, you could cry and calm down after I left. This showed that you could trust me as well as the sitter. You could also feel guilty when you do something wrong that is the third stage of development as explained by Erikson. At age 15 you got a boyfriend, and you wanted to go out with him which is the six stage marked by development of isolation and intimacy. Your growth was well, and you passed through all developmental stages.
